Chennai, Dec 12 (UNI) Janata Party President Dr Subramanian Swamy claimed that the Narendra Modi - led BJP government would be voted back to power in Gujarat with an absoute majority.

Speaking at questions at a press conference here on the scenario in Gujarat in the wake of the charges of encounter death and the Election Commission's(EC) notice to Mr Modi, Dr Swamy said ''one should wait for the EC's 'verdict''.

Dr Swamy claimed that when an extremist takes on the police and acts against the country, he cannot take refuge under fundamental rights guaranteed in the Constitution. The law is very clear vis-a vis fundamental rights, he added.

Dr Swamy took on the Sethusamudram Shipping Canal Project(SSCP) and reiterated that the ''project was now doomed and alleged that the the union shipping Minister had been misleading the people by issuing statemets that the SSCP would be completed by November 2008.

He also claimed that the National Remote Sensing Agency of the ministry of Space under the Prime Minister and a report of Geological Survey of India (GSI) had categorically stated that Rama Sethu was constructed during the Ramayana period.

Hence it qualifies to be an ancient monument of national heritage and cannot be damaged in any way under the Ancient Monuments and Archaeological Sites And Remains Act, he argned.

''This means that the SSCP was not permissible under the law and was an illegal project,'' he added.
